US House votes to curb Trump on Iran war as talks stall

US House votes to curb Trump on Iran war as talks stall

Summary

The US House of Representatives voted for a resolution to stop American military action in Iran. This move is symbolic and challenges President Donald Trump as negotiations with Iran remain stalled.

Key Facts

  • The US House passed a resolution to halt US military action in Iran.
  • The resolution is symbolic and does not have the force of law.
  • Talks between the US and Iran to resolve conflict and reopen the Strait of Hormuz have not succeeded.
  • The Strait of Hormuz is an important waterway for global oil supply.
  • The vote is seen as a setback for President Donald Trump’s approach to Iran.
  • Recent talks have involved tense discussions and some violence.
  • The resolution shows growing concern in the US about the conflict with Iran.
